Understanding Connectomes
The connectome represents a detailed mapping of nervous tissue, focusing on the intricate connections between neurons at a scale smaller than a millimeter. By employing advanced electron microscopy, researchers aim to create exhaustive wiring diagrams of neural circuits, potentially revolutionizing our understanding of brain connectivity.
